Charity Trek

Trekking in Nepal combined with hands-on service: trail cleanup, school maintenance, classroom painting, infrastructure support and library development.

A group of Nepali hosts and international visitors wearing marigold garlands outside a building
A visiting group welcomed at the start of a Charity Trek programme.

Charity Trek is run in partnership with Mountain Routes. Participants trek, and they also work: trail cleanup, school cleaning and maintenance, classroom painting, infrastructure support and library development.

It is presented as a way to take part rather than as a fifth programme pillar. The service days feed directly into the same schools, trails and community sites the programmes already support.
